📖Program Curriculum
Year 1 Students are required to study the following compulsory modules
Law of Torts 30 credits Advocacy and Professional Ethics 15 credits Law of Contract Level 5 30 credits Public Law LEVEL 5 30 credits Jurisprudence 15 credits European Union Law 15 credits Civil and Criminal Procedure Level 5 15 credits Year 2 Students are required to study the following compulsory modules
Equity and Trusts 30 credits Land Law Level 6 30 credits Criminal Law Senior Status 30 credits Students are required to choose 60 credits from this list of options
Company and Partnership Law 30 credits Law of Evidence 30 credits Family Law 30 credits Internationalernationalellectual Property Law 30 credits Dissertation in Law 30 credits Financial Services Law Regulation and Practice 30 credits Competition Law 30 credits Legal Work Placement 30 credits Commercial Law 30 credits Internationalernationalernational Law 30 credits Advanced Criminal Law 30 credits Transnational Organised Illegal Networks 30 credits Information Technology Law 30 credits Internationalernationalernational Human Rights Law 30 credits
